On Friday, December 29th, Thunder Bay offers a variety of entertainment options. Anchor & Ore presents "Jazz & Old Fashioned Fridays" featuring Mood Indigo, starting at 6:00 pm. Atmos hosts "Life of Kai" at 6:00 pm, promising a night of great vibes. If you're in the mood for an otherworldly experience, head to Fort William Historical Park for "Holidays On Mars" at the David Thompson Astronomical Observatory at 7:00 pm. For those who enjoy karaoke, The Westfort and Waterhouse are hosting sessions starting at 8:00 pm. Black Pirates Pub features "Cat Sabbath" with Psycho Therapy and Brazen Bull at 9:00 pm for a night of rock. If you prefer live bands, check out "The JB Band" at Wayland Bar & Grill starting at 10:00 pm. Whether you're into jazz, karaoke, or live music, Thunder Bay has something for everyone on this Friday night.
